About Commercial Real Estate Law in Paranaque City, Philippines:

Paranaque City, located in the Philippines, has a thriving commercial real estate sector. Commercial real estate refers to properties that are used for business purposes, such as office buildings, retail spaces, and industrial facilities. The laws governing commercial real estate in Paranaque City are designed to regulate and protect the rights and interests of individuals and companies involved in these types of transactions.

Why You May Need a Lawyer:

Navigating the complexities of commercial real estate transactions can be challenging. It is highly recommended to seek the help of a lawyer in the following situations:

1. Buying or selling commercial property: Whether you are a buyer or seller, a lawyer can assist you in reviewing contracts, negotiating terms, and ensuring a smooth transaction.

2. Lease agreements: If you are entering into a lease agreement for a commercial property, a lawyer can provide guidance and help ensure that your interests are protected.

3. Land use and zoning issues: When dealing with commercial real estate, there may be regulations and restrictions related to land use and zoning. A lawyer can help you understand these complexities and ensure compliance.

4. Disputes and litigation: In case of disputes, such as breach of contracts or disagreements over property rights, a lawyer with expertise in commercial real estate can represent your interests.

5. Due diligence: Before entering into any commercial real estate transaction, it is crucial to conduct proper due diligence. A lawyer can assist you in researching property titles, permits, and other legal aspects to minimize risks.

Local Laws Overview:

To engage in commercial real estate dealings in Paranaque City, it is essential to understand some key local laws. These include:

1. Republic Act No. 4726: This law, also known as the Condominium Act, governs the ownership and development of condominiums in the Philippines, including Paranaque City.

2. City Ordinances: Paranaque City has specific ordinances related to land use, zoning regulations, and building codes. Familiarizing yourself with these ordinances is important to ensure compliance and avoid legal issues.

3. Environmental laws: Paranaque City upholds environmental laws that regulate the construction and operation of commercial real estate properties to protect the environment and public health.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. Can foreign individuals or entities own commercial real estate in Paranaque City?

Yes, foreign individuals and entities can own commercial real estate in Paranaque City, subject to certain restrictions and limitations under the Foreign Investment Act and other relevant laws.

2. What are the tax implications of owning commercial real estate in Paranaque City?

Owners of commercial real estate in Paranaque City are subject to various taxes, including real property tax, value-added tax (VAT), and documentary stamp tax. It is advisable to consult a tax expert to understand your specific tax obligations.

3. What is the process for obtaining building permits for commercial construction?

To obtain building permits in Paranaque City, you need to submit the necessary documents to the local government's Building Official. The application will undergo review and inspection to ensure compliance with zoning regulations and building codes.

4. Are there any restrictions on leasing commercial properties in Paranaque City?

There may be restrictions on leasing commercial properties in Paranaque City, depending on the zoning regulations and specific ordinances. It is important to consult the local government or a lawyer to understand any limitations or requirements.

5. What is the typical duration for commercial lease agreements in Paranaque City?

The duration of commercial lease agreements in Paranaque City varies but is often negotiated between the landlord and the tenant. It can range from a few years to several decades, depending on the nature of the business and the mutual agreement between the parties involved.
